Healthy Birth Day, Inc. is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ization based in Des Moines, Iowa dedicated to healthy birth outcomes. We created the successful Count the Kicks public health campaign which has helped reduce Iowa’s stillbirth rate by 32% while the rest of the country has remained stagnant. Our evidence-based program teaches expectant parents the method for and importance of counting their baby's kicks daily in the third trimester of pregnancy. Our goal is to reduce the rest of the country's stillbirth rate by 32 percent, saving 7,500 babies every single year. Five Iowa moms who all lost daughters to stillbirth or infant death in the early 2000s turned their grief into fuel by creating the Count the Kicks awareness campaign in 2008. Kerry Biondi-Morlan, Jan Caruthers, Janet Petersen, Kate Safris and Tiffan Yamen are pioneers in stillbirth prevention, taking important fetal movement research from Norway and turning it into a successful mom-centered campaign. Moms everywhere can download the FREE Count the Kicks app which is available in the Google Play and iTunes online stores. The app, which is available in more than 15 languages, allows expectant moms to monitor their baby’s movement, record the history, set a daily reminder, count for single babies and twins.
